Kuchli Population - Birbhum, West Bengal
Kuchli is a medium size village located in Bolpur Sriniketan Block of Birbhum district, West Bengal with total 228 families residing. The Kuchli village has population of 1000 of which 522 are males while 478 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Kuchli village population of children with age 0-6 is 97 which makes up 9.70 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kuchli village is 916 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Kuchli as per census is 702, lower than West Bengal average of 956.
Kuchli village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Kuchli village was 75.30 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Kuchli Male literacy stands at 79.57 % while female literacy rate was 70.78 %.

Kuchli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 228 | - | - |
Population | 1,000 | 522 | 478 |
Child (0-6) | 97 | 57 | 40 |
Schedule Caste | 416 | 221 | 195 |
Schedule Tribe | 124 | 67 | 57 |
Literacy | 75.30 % | 79.57 % | 70.78 % |
Total Workers | 460 | 321 | 139 |
Main Worker | 387 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 73 | 15 | 58 |
